Offhand

Offhand adjective - Made or done without previous thought or preparation.
Usage example: an offhand comment that later caused the politician much embarrassment

Unprepared

Unprepared adjective - Made or done without previous thought or preparation.
Usage example: an obviously unprepared acceptance speech by the surprise winner
